Abstract

The utility model discloses a metering turnover cabinet capable of flexibly storing metering appliances, which comprises a turnover cabinet body, wherein a cabinet door is arranged on the front side of the turnover cabinet body, an operating table is fixedly arranged on the side surface of the turnover cabinet body, an intelligent electronic lock is fixedly arranged on the surface of the cabinet door, and a placing plate is fixedly arranged on the inner wall of the turnover cabinet body. According to the turnover cabinet, metering devices with different volumes are placed on the upper surface of the placing plate, if the volume of the metering device is too large, the sliding plate is moved leftwards and rightwards according to the volume of the metering device, so that the metering device can be placed on the upper surface of the placing plate and is fixed by the sliding plate and the clamping plate, after adjustment is finished, the knob is rotated to drive the threaded sleeve to rotate, the left position and the right position of the clamping plate are fixed, the sliding plate can be limited by the three limiting rods, the sliding plate cannot fall down when sliding leftwards and rightwards, the metering devices with different volumes can be stored by adjusting the left position and the right position of the sliding plate, and the use flexibility of the turnover cabinet is greatly improved.

Description

Measurement turnover cabinet capable of flexibly storing measurement instruments
Technical Field
The utility model relates to the technical field of metering transfer cabinets, in particular to a metering transfer cabinet capable of flexibly storing metering appliances.
Background
Along with the continuous improvement of people's standard of living standard, resident's power consumption demand is bigger and bigger, in order to strengthen the standardized construction of electric power measurement, provides measurement utensil storehouse storage management level, for the support of the electric power measurement business that the power supply provided, has appeared measurement turnover cabinet for management and deposit the measurement utensil.
However, in the prior art, when the metering device is actually used, the types of the metering devices to be stored are different, so that the volumes of the metering devices are different, the traditional metering transfer cabinet can only store the metering devices with single volume, if the metering devices with overlarge volumes are required to be stored, a power company needs to purchase the corresponding metering transfer cabinet, and the operation cost of the power company is increased while the flexibility is lacked.
SUMMERY OF THE UTILITY MODEL
The present invention is directed to a measurement turnover cabinet capable of flexibly storing measurement instruments, so as to solve the problems mentioned in the background art.
In order to achieve the purpose, the utility model provides the following technical scheme: the utility model provides a can store measurement turnover cabinet of measurement utensil in a flexible way, includes turnover cabinet body, the front of turnover cabinet body is provided with the cabinet door, the fixed operation panel that is provided with in side surface of turnover cabinet body, the fixed surface of cabinet door is provided with intelligent electronic lock, the fixed board of placing that is provided with in inner wall of turnover cabinet body, it is close to the fixed board that is provided with of one end of cabinet door to place the board, the activity of the upper surface of turnover cabinet body is provided with the sliding plate, the fixed gag lever post that is provided with of inner wall of turnover cabinet body, the lower fixed surface of turnover cabinet body is provided with the universal wheel.
Preferably, the upper surface of the operating platform is fixedly connected with a monitoring probe, the front surface of the operating platform is fixedly connected with a display screen, a magnetic card inductor and a password keyboard respectively, the magnetic card inductor and the password keyboard are electrically connected with the intelligent electronic lock respectively, the password keyboard is electrically connected with the display screen, the monitoring probe is electrically connected with an external monitoring computer, and the display screen, the magnetic card inductor and the password keyboard are electrically connected with an external power supply respectively.
Preferably, the surface of the clamping plate is provided with a sliding groove, one end of the sliding plate, which is close to the clamping plate, is fixedly connected with a screw rod, one end of the screw rod is provided with a threaded sleeve, one end of the threaded sleeve is fixedly connected with a knob, and the screw rod is movably connected with the inner wall of the sliding groove.
Preferably, round holes are formed in the surface of the sliding plate, the limiting rods are movably connected to the inner walls of the round holes, the number of the limiting rods and the number of the round holes are three, two of the round holes are formed in one end, close to the clamping plate, of the sliding plate, and the other round hole is formed in one end, far away from the clamping plate, of the sliding plate.
Preferably, the placing plate has a bevel angle, an included angle between the placing plate and the horizontal direction is 12 degrees, the sliding plate is movably connected to the upper surface of the placing plate, and two ends of the sliding plate are respectively movably connected to the side surface of the clamping plate and the inner wall of the turnover cabinet body.
Preferably, the placing plates and the locking plates are seven in number, the seven placing plates and the locking plates are fixedly connected to the inner wall of the turnover cabinet body along the vertical direction, the number of the sliding plates is forty-nine, and every seven sliding plates are movably connected to the upper surface of one placing plate.
Compared with the prior art, the utility model has the beneficial effects that:
1. according to the utility model, metering devices with different volumes are placed on the upper surface of the placing plate, if the volume of the metering device is too large, the position of the sliding plate is moved leftwards and rightwards according to the volume of the metering device, so that the metering device can be placed on the upper surface of the placing plate and is fixed by the sliding plate and the clamping plate, after the adjustment is finished, the knob is rotated to drive the threaded sleeve to rotate, the left position and the right position of the clamping plate are fixed, the sliding plate can be limited by the three limiting rods, so that the sliding plate cannot fall down when sliding leftwards and rightwards, the metering devices with different volumes can be stored by adjusting the left position and the right position of the sliding plate, and the use flexibility of the turnover cabinet is greatly improved;
2. the intelligent electronic lock can be unlocked in two modes of a specific password and a specific magnetic card, so that the situation that the cabinet door cannot be opened when the magnetic card is lost is prevented, a monitoring probe can be used for monitoring and shooting unlocking personnel when the intelligent electronic lock is unlocked, video data can be stored in a monitoring computer, and videos can be taken for verification when the metering device is accidentally lost or damaged.
